BACKGROUND: Variant high pathogenicity avian influenza (HPAI) H5 viruses have recently emerged as a result of reassortment of the H5 haemagglutinin (HA) gene with different neuraminidase (NA) genes, including NA1, NA2, NA5, NA6 and NA8. These viruses form a newly proposed HA clade 2.3.4.4 (previously provisionally referred to as clade 2.3.4.6), and have been implicated in disease outbreaks in poultry in China, South Korea, Laos, Japan and Vietnam and a human fatality in China. There is real concern that this new clade may be wide spread and not readily identified using existing diagnostic algorithms.Entities:

The influenza A virus, segment 4 hemagglutinin (HA) gene sequences were identified by BLASTn analysis of HA sequence from A/duck/Laos/XBY004/2014(H5N6) (GenBank accession performed on 2nd September, 2014). The listed strains share 100% identity to the target region of probes D-720 PRB and D-724 PRB (MGB) of the proposed H5 clade 2.3.4.4 specific qRT-PCR assays. The H5 strains are sorted by N subtype N1, N2, N5, N6, and N8.
